> > > I just thought I'd take a look at the nightly 3.7 build, and noticed
> > > that when I installed glusterfs-fuse for the client it pulls in
> > > glusterfs-server? Also the version is bumped to 3.8?
> >
> > After the branching of release-3.7, the master branch has now been
> > tagged with v3.8dev. Your system is probably setup to use the nightly
> > builds of the master branch. You should be able to update your yum .repo
> > file so that these packages are used:
> >
> >
> > http://download.gluster.org/pub/gluster/glusterfs/nightly/glusterfs-3.7/
